Bhelani

Bhelani is a village located in Chhatna subdivision of Bankura district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 23.1km away from sub-district headquarter Chhatna. Bankura is the district headquarter of Bhelani village. As per 2009 stats, Dhaban is the gram panchayat of Bhelani village.

About Bhelani

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bhelani is 326362. The village spans a total geographical area of 281.26 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 722137. Bankura is nearest town to Bhelani village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 39km away.

Population of Bhelani

According to the 2011 Census, Bhelani has a total population of about 793, with approximately 397 males and 396 females. The sex ratio is around 997 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 103 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 156 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 629. The overall literacy rate is approximately 50.82%, with male literacy at about 64.23% and female literacy near 37.37%. There are around 164 households in the village. Connectivity of Bhelani

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bhelani. As per the 2011 stats, Bhelani had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
